Understanding Canadians’ knowledge of consular services : final report / prepared for Global Affairs Canada.FR5-252/2026E-PDF

"The last research GAC conducted on Canada’s consular services was the 2018 Consular Policy and Programs Report, which covered Canadians’ travel patterns, how they prepare for trips, how they use GAC’s consular services and their level of confidence in them. Since this study is over seven years old, recent data is required to gauge Canadians’ current level of knowledge of consular services"--page 2.
